One World International Scholarships an initiative by the BC Scholarship Society are awarded to students participating in study, or work-abroad programs that are either experiential learning opportunities (language or cultural training), or that provide credits toward the BC academic credential they are working towards.

One World International Scholarships

Eligibility for One World International Scholarships

To be eligible to apply for this Scholarship, you…

  • are a Canadian citizen, permanent resident (landed immigrant), convention refugee, or protected person living in Canada;
  • are a resident of British Columbia, defined as having a primary residence in the province for at least 12 consecutive months prior to the date of full-time enrollment in the program for which the scholarship is applied for;
  • have clearly demonstrated significant community and/or school involvement and academic achievement, supported by two references submitted with the application;
  • are enrolled full-time in an academic program of at least one year at a BC public post-secondary institution leading to a credential and have been accepted into an eligible international program outside of Canada or United States;
  • can demonstrate links between the international experience you are pursuing and your educational or career goals;
  • are not planning an international experience in a country from which you have immigrated within the past 5 years;
  • have not previously received a One World International Scholarship or a Premier’s International Scholarship;
  • plan to begin your international experience before May 1, 2024; and,
  • will return to British Columbia after completing your  international experience for further education or work.

NOTE: These Scholarships are adjudicated and awarded by your institution.

How to Apply

  • Review the Eligibility Criteria for the Scholarship;
  • Obtain “unofficial” transcripts of all your post-secondary studies (in British Columbia and elsewhere);
  • Obtain two references using the forms included with the Application (link below). One reference must be completed by an academic reference (commenting on your academic abilities) and one by a non-academic reference (commenting on your volunteer or extra-curricular activities);
  • Submit the completed Application including your transcripts and reference forms to the International Awards Office of your institution.

Benefits of One World International Scholarships

The scholarship offers a $2000 – $5,000 amount, to help you with your studies
